"Power Electronics: Principles and Applications" by Joseph Vithayathil is a highly regarded textbook for electrical engineering students, balancing theoretical foundations with practical industrial applications. The text offers in-depth coverage of power semiconductor devices, converters, and specialized topics like vector control. It is an excellent textbook for understanding the core principles of how power electronics work. If you are struggling to understand how an inverter switches or how a thyristor is triggered, this is a great resource. However, for cutting-edge applications or modern device physics, you would need a supplementary text (like Daniel W. Hart or Ned Mohan ).
